Frontend development (React.js) Course by Manikandan

DurationDuration:90 hours

Batch TypeBatch Type:Weekend and Weekdays

LanguagesLanguages:English, Tamil

Class TypeClass Type:Online

Class Type Course Fee:

₹20,000.00Full Course

Course Content

The Frontend Development (React.js) Course by Manikandan is a structured online program designed to help learners build strong foundations in web development and progress toward creating modern, interactive user interfaces. This course is suitable for beginners as well as learners with basic coding knowledge who want to understand how real-world websites and web applications are built from scratch.

The course covers the complete frontend stack—HTML, CSS, JavaScript, and React.js—with a step-by-step approach that focuses on concept clarity, hands-on practice, and practical implementation. By the end of the course, learners will be able to design responsive web pages and develop dynamic frontend applications using React.

All sessions are conducted online, making the course accessible and flexible for students, working professionals, and aspiring developers.

What Students Will Learn

HTML (HyperText Markup Language)

  • Purpose: Structure of a webpage

  • HTML is used to create the basic layout of a website.

Key Concepts:

  • Tags (<html>, <head>, <body>)

  • Headings (<h1> to <h6>)

  • Paragraphs (<p>)

  • Links (<a>)

  • Images (<img>)

  • Lists (<ul>, <ol>)

  • Forms (<form>, <input>, <button>)

CSS (Cascading Style Sheets)

  • Purpose: Styling the webpage

CSS is used to design and make the website attractive.

Key Concepts:

  • Colors & Backgrounds

  • Fonts & Text styling

  • Box Model (margin, padding, border)

  • Flexbox

  • Grid

  • Responsive Design

  • Media Queries

JavaScript (JS)

  • Purpose: Add interactivity

  • JavaScript makes websites dynamic and interactive.

Key Concepts:

  • Variables (var, let, const)

  • Data Types

  • Functions

  • Loops

  • Conditions (if/else)

  • DOM Manipulation

  • Events

  • ES6 Features (arrow functions, promises, etc.)

React JS

  • Purpose: Build modern web applications

  • React is a JavaScript library used to build fast and reusable UI components.

Key Concepts:

  • Components

  • JSX

  • Props

  • State

  • Hooks (useState, useEffect)

  • Routing

  • API Integration

Teaching Method

Mode: Live online classes with guided explanations

  • Step-by-step teaching from basics to advanced topics

  • Practical coding examples and demonstrations

  • Focus on understanding concepts, not just syntax

  • Learner-friendly pace suitable for beginners

Why Learn from This Tutor

Manikandan follows a clear, fundamentals-first teaching approach, helping learners understand how frontend technologies work together rather than learning them in isolation. The course structure supports gradual skill development, making complex concepts easier to understand and apply.

Benefits / Learning Outcomes

After completing this course, learners will be able to:

  • Build structured and responsive web pages

  • Style websites using modern CSS layouts

  • Add interactivity using JavaScript

  • Develop frontend applications using React.js

  • Understand component-based UI development

  • Gain confidence to pursue further web development learning or projects

Skills

Html 5, Html and Css, React.js, Javascript, Web Development

Tutor

Manikandan Profile Pic
Manikandan

Manikandan is a dedicated Online Web Development tutor with 1 year of teaching experience, focused on helping beginners and early-stage learners build a st...

0.0 Average Ratings

0 Reviews

1 Years Experience

166/ kalipalayam

Students Rating

0.0

Course Rating

Blogs

Explore All
arrow
arrow